Maybe the Naked Shoe Trend isn’t Such a Bad Idea

It worked for Cinderella...

See-through shoes are no news to us; they’ve been lingering around since who knows when but we’ll be honest, we’ve been reluctant to take them out for a spin. The main reason being that the sheer sight of them sends our feet into a sweat, but if beauties like Kim Kardashian and the rest of her clan, Chrissy Tiegen and even our very own Laura Byrne can make the trend work on the regular, then surely they can’t be that bad...

On the fence? Here are some points that make a solid case for see-through shoes:

Clear straps will give the illusion of longer legs – there’s no defined line to cut you off at the ankle or even at the toe.

The struggle to find the perfect colour is over, this shade is universal.

You don’t have to think about matching your shoes to the rest of your outfit, these will blend right in.

They add a hint of sparkle without stealing the spotlight from your dress or statement earrings.

Say someone spills their drink on your shoes that night – now you can just dab dry like nothing ever happened.
